Pricing
Priced on tracked profiles. Not events, not data volume, not seat count.
Two tiers for self-serve growth teams. The number of events you fire and the number of people in your workspace don't affect your bill. Profile count does — because that's what you're actually syncing.
Starter
$199/month
Save 20% with annual billing
- Up to 50,000 tracked profiles
- Up to 3 sync destinations
- Daily audience updates
- 30-day event lookback window
- 3 team seats
- Email support
- Event Explorer
- Identity resolution
Growth
$499/month
Save 20% with annual billing
- Up to 250,000 tracked profiles
- Unlimited sync destinations
- Hourly audience updates
- 90-day event lookback window
- 10 team seats
- Priority email + chat support
- Event Explorer
- Identity resolution
Need warehouse scale or SSO? Contact us for Enterprise pricing.
Compare plans
What's included in each tier
| Feature | Starter | Growth |
|---|---|---|
| Tracked profiles | Up to 50,000 | Up to 250,000 |
| Sync destinations | Up to 3 | Unlimited |
| Audience update frequency | Daily | Hourly |
| Event lookback window | 30 days | 90 days |
| Team seats | 3 | 10 |
| Behavioral rule builder | ||
| Identity resolution | ||
| Event Explorer | ||
| Delta-update syncs | ||
| Match rate reporting | ||
| SSO (SAML) | Add-on | |
| Custom destinations (webhook) | ||
| Support | Priority email + chat |
FAQ
Common questions about how billing works
A tracked profile is a unique resolved identity in your event stream — a
user_id after sign-up, or an anonymous_id before. When two anonymous sessions stitch to the same user_id, they count as one profile, not two. Billing is based on peak monthly active profiles, not total historical profiles in the database.Yes. Starter includes up to 3 destinations; Growth has no destination limit. A destination is a single connected account — one Google Ads account and one Meta Business Manager account counts as 2. Each audience within a destination can have its own sync schedule and conditions.
We'll email you a heads-up before you hit the limit. Audiences continue syncing; we won't hard-cut your data flow. You'll be prompted to upgrade within 30 days of consistent overage. No surprise charges.
Once, at setup. For the warehouse connector path, your data team grants Segmentloom read-only access to the events table — a 30-minute configuration task. For the JS SDK or server-side API, your engineers add the integration once and it runs from there. After initial setup, the growth team builds and manages audiences independently — no further engineering involvement needed for day-to-day audience operations.
We're in invite-only early access. There's no trial in the traditional sense — instead, we do a guided onboarding session where we connect your event source, verify profile resolution, and build your first audience together. You see real data from your own warehouse before you commit to anything. Pricing applies when you go live after onboarding.
Your first audience sync, on your own event data
Request access and we'll run a guided setup session — your event source connected, your first behavioral audience configured, synced to a destination. Under an hour, start to finish.